

Ⅱ What is a Microcontroller?Ī Microcontroller is a VLSI IC that, along with some other peripherals such as memory ( RAM and ROM), I/O ports, timers/counters, communication interface, ADC, etc., contains a CPU (processor).Ī microprocessor (which was built before the microcontroller) is merely a processor (CPU) and does not have the peripherals mentioned above. So, an introduction to the 8051 microcontrollers and some of the fundamentals of the 8051 microcontrollers will be given in this article.īut before we get into the 8051 Microcontroller Introduction and Fundamentals, we need to talk a bit about what a microcontroller is and the distinction between a microprocessorand a microcontroller. While 8051 Microcontroller can seem a bit out of date, we believe that Microcontrollers, Embedded Systems, and Programming are some of the best platforms to get started with (both C and Assembly).


There are several features of the 8051 Microcontroller such as Serial Communication, Timers, Interrupts, etc., and thus many students and beginners begin their work on the 8051 Microcontroller principle of Microcontrollers (although this trend seems to be changed with the introduction of Arduino). In differen t fields, such as embedded systems, consumer electronics, vehicles, etc., the 8051 Microcontroller is one of the most prominent and most commonly used microcontrollers. The 8051 microcontroller series, technically referred to as the Intel MCS-51 Architecture, was developed by Intel in 1980 and was very popular in the 80's (still are popular).
